Coverage for mindsdb / integrations / handlers / huggingface_handler / settings.py: 0%

2 statements  

« prev     ^ index     » next       coverage.py v7.13.1, created at 2026-01-21 00:36 +0000

1from mindsdb.integrations.handlers.huggingface_handler.finetune import ( 

2 _finetune_cls, 

3 _finetune_fill_mask, 

4 _finetune_question_answering, 

5 _finetune_summarization, 

6 _finetune_text_generation, 

7 _finetune_translate, 

8) 

9 

10# todo once we have moved predict tasks functions into a separate function 

11# PREDICT_MAP = { 

12# 'text-classification': self.predict_text_classification, 

13# 'zero-shot-classification': self.predict_zero_shot, 

14# 'translation': self.predict_translation, 

15# 'summarization': self.predict_summarization, 

16# 'fill-mask': self.predict_fill_mask 

17# } 

18 

19FINETUNE_MAP = { 

20 "text-classification": _finetune_cls, 

21 "zero-shot-classification": _finetune_cls, 

22 "translation": _finetune_translate, 

23 "summarization": _finetune_summarization, 

24 "fill-mask": _finetune_fill_mask, 

25 "text-generation": _finetune_text_generation, 

26 "question-answering": _finetune_question_answering, 

27}